Alpacas at Sawdust Hill Farm
25448 Port Gamble Road NE
Poulsbo, WA 98370
360.286.9999
Sawdust Hill Alpaca Farm is a 15-acre working llama, miniature llama and alpaca working farm, complete with chickens, guard dogs and cats. Come and pet the alpacas, and kiss the llamas. Shop in our farm store for beautiful yarns made from our alpaca fiber, as well as socks, hats, scarves, sweaters, coats, toys and jewelry. Enjoy being out in the green pastures with the animals! Aurora Valentinetti Puppet Museum & Evergreen Children's Theatre
257 4th ST
Bremerton, WA 98337
360.373.2992
A museum of theatrical puppets representing many different puppet types and different cultures from around the world.

KIDIMU Kids Discovery Museum
301 Ravine Lane
Bainbridge Island, WA 98110
206.855.4650
KIDIMU is a destination for children and their adults to explore art, science, and culture through hands-on exhibits, daily art projects, cultural and scientific programs. The Kids Discovery Museum blurs the line between learning and playing to inspire a lifelong journey of discovery. From Seattle, you can walk on the ferry and to KIDIMU without the need of a car: Upon disembarking the ferry, exit the ferry building, walk up the hill and across Winslow Way. Turn left and walk about 100 yards to Ravine Lane, on your right. You can see KiDiMu, at 301 Ravine Lane. Free First Thursdays!
